ITV is set to revive the musical talent contest — this time for hit Abba show, Mamma Mia!

It will follow in the footsteps of TV shows like Any Dream Will Do, How do you Solve a Problem like Maria?, I’d Do Anything and Superstar, in which contestants competed to win leading West End stage roles.

The eight-part series, from the same production team which makes Britain’s Got Talent, could even see the judging panel feature Hollywood star Amanda Seyfried, 36.

She played Sophie Sheridan in the 2008 movie version, alongside Meryl Streep.

Stage show Mamma Mia! — made up of Abba songs — has been a huge hit since its London debut in 1999.

A TV insider said: “ITV are clearly riding the wave of renewed interest in all things Abba, not to mention a renewed interest in hit formats of old.

“This has been seen as an obvious choice for a reboot for years, but producers were waiting for the right musical and right moment.”

Abba have been back in the limelight this year after the band’s hologram virtual stage show, Abba Voyage, proved a huge hit when it launched in London.

The new ITV show, created by Thames and set to air next year, would see a string of rising stars take to the stage in front of a panel of celebrity experts, with the viewing public voting on who makes it through to perform another week.
